Goebel Mothers Series wall plaque – mother hare with young – first edition 1975 – signed Bochmann – luxurious framing
Description
This is an original wall plaque from the Mothers Series by Goebel.
An intimate depiction of a mother hare with two young, executed in high relief and fully hand-painted.
The back side explicitly states
1975 First Edition
Mothers Series
Entirely hand painted
by Goebel
West Germany
1975
Model number 52507/19
This confirms a first edition from 1975, produced in West Germany. Not a reissue.
On the front, the name G. Bochmann is visible in the porcelain.
This is the relief signature of Gerhard Bochmann, sculptor and modeler at Goebel.
The signature is incorporated into the design and confirms an original Goebel model from the Mothers Series.
It is not a painter's signature but a designer's mark.
The plaque is made of porcelain with very refined modeling. The fur texture, expression, and depth of the relief demonstrate Goebel's high level of craftsmanship in the 1970s. Mother-and-child representations are among the most beloved themes within this series.
